Minerals And Mining (Health, Safety And Technical Regulations, 2012) (L.I. 2182)Regulation 51(1) A person may perform the functions of a resident engineer in a mine, if that person proves to the satisfaction of the Chief Inspector that that person(a) holds a recognised degree or diploma in mechanical, electrical or electromechanical engineering, or an equivalent qualification and in addition has complied with the examination requirements;(b) has satisfied a board of examiners comprising at least one resident engineer, of that person's knowledge of these Regulations, and of the installation, commissioning, maintenance, and decommissioning practices of machinery, plants and equipment on the mine; and(c) has at least five years relevant practical experience.(2) The Chief Inspector shall appoint the board of examiners under sub-regulation (1). |
